Setting Up Online Case Forms for NetSuite OneWorld
By default, the Subsidiary field is also included on online case forms as a hidden search field. You can set the value of the subsidiary field on the form by including the subsidiary parameter in the URL. You can also choosinge a default subsidiary on the Set Up Workflow subtab of the online case form.
If the field remains hidden on the form, the subsidiary will not be seen by the customer submitting the form.
The Default Subsidiary preference is used to define the appropriate subsidiary to associate with a case when no subsidiary is explicitly set on the form. It determines the following:
-
Which customers are considered when NetSuite searches to determine if there is an existing record for the person submitting the form.
NetSuite only considers the customers associated with the subsidiary set on the form when determining if there is an existing record.
For example, you set the Handle Duplicate Records preference to create a new customer record when no match is found. NetSuite creates the record and associates it with the subsidiary set on the form. If no subsidiary is set on the form and no default subsidiary is set, the new record is associated with your root parent subsidiary.
Another example, there is no matching record and the Handle Duplicate Records preference is not set to create a new record. NetSuite associates the new case with an anonymous customer record. If a subsidiary is set, the case is associated with that subsidiary's anonymous customer placeholder.
-
The subsidiary set on the case record that is created.
If a subsidiary is not set through the form or through a URL parameter, the default subsidiary is applied. If a matching customer is not found for the case, the anonymous customer placeholder for that subsidiary is used. In case profiles, the value in the subsidiary filter takes precedence over that entered in the default subsidiary field on the online case form.
To set up an online case form:
-
Go to Setup > Support > Case Management > Online Case Forms > New.
-
On the Select Field subtab, select either the Company Name field or the First and Last Name fields and mark them mandatory.
-
Click the Set Up Workflow subtab.
-
In the Default Subsidiary field, select the subsidiary you want to associate with cases submitted through this form.
-
Set other options on the form. For example, you might place a logo on the form that is specific to a subsidiary.
-
Click Save.
